Unease As CEO Of Para-Military Agency ‘Elongates’ Tenure

Staff of the National Park Service who are holders of the Higher National Diploma degrees are unhappy that Ibrahim Goni is still the Conservator General and Chief Executive Officer of the agency after exceeding the mandatory 60 years of age and 35 years in public service.

Goni, who started his working career in 1983 at Kainji Lake National Park, New Bussa, Niger State, has now spent 38 years in service. He’s also above 63 years having been born in 1953, according to his bio published on the NPS website.

He was posted to the NPS headquarters Abuja as Assistant Conservator General (Ecology & Resource Management) in 2014. But on April 14, 2017, when he had just one more year to serve before retirement, he was appointed the Conservator General.

The NPS is categorized as a para-military agency like the Nigerian Immigration Services, the Nigeria Customs Service, the Nigerian Correctional Service and others.

But unlike other para-military agencies in the country, the NPS under Goni has refused to implement a Federal Government directive abolishing the dichotomy between HND and University degree.

In a letter sent to THE WHISTLER by a group of NPS employees across the country who entered the service with the HND certificate, they ask why the NPS has refused to abolish the dichotomy.

“All other paramilitary agencies have obeyed the directives of the federal government on the abolition of the HND/BSc disparity and seniority restored except the National Park Service.

“The headquarters are quick to implement any directive that doesn’t favour the staff but are reluctant to implement the one that will improve work efficiency, productivity and upliftment of its staff,” the employees alleged.

They claimed that the disparity has led to stagnation of many of them at Compass 12, which had also promoted a situation of low morale when junior staff overtake their senior in promotion because they have university degrees.

Goni has also been accused of not approving promotion of staff as and when due while morale is said to be generally low because of his leadership style.
They alleged that the headquarters has “highjacked” the functions of the seven Unit Parks under the NPS, rendering them redundant and killing morale of staff.

“We want the Park Service to be moving in tandem with other sister paramilitary agencies in term of staff welfare and exposure,” the NPS staff stated.

While reacting to the allegation of Goni overstaying in service, Yakubu Haruna Zull, the Public Relations Officer of NPS, told THE WHISTLER that the office of CG/CEO is a political office and has nothing to do with the number of years spent in service.

On the disparity between HND/Bsc, he said it is the 14-member Governing Board of the NPS that is responsible for determining the policy direction of the Service, and not the CG.

The NPS was established to, among others; preserve and manage vegetation and wild animals in the national parks.
